Ethan Ruffin Punches Ticket to NCAA National Championships

LEXINGTON, Ken. - FDU sophomore jumper Ethan Ruffin punched his ticket to the 2026 NCAA Outdoor Track and Field National Championships by qualifying in the Men's High Jump Event at the regional event Friday afternoon in Lexington. 

Ruffin started the meet with a clearance of the 2.06 meter bar on his first of three allotted attempts. After a long wait, Ruffin struggled to clear the 2.11 meter bar, but showed up when it mattered, clearing the bar on his final attempt, putting himself in a position to clinch a spot in nationals with one more clearance.

Ruffin cleared the 2.16 meter bar for the third and the most important time this season, putting himself inside the top 12 of the east region, which is good enough to send him through to the National Championship round, set to take place on Friday, June 12th. 

Ruffin is the first Knight to qualify for the National Championships since fellow jumper Salif Mane not only qualified, but won the National Championship in the Men's Triple Jump in 2024. 
 
WHAT'S NEXT
Ruffin will next compete in those National Championships, which take place at Hayward Field in Eugene, Ore. on Friday June 12th.
